About The Position

Tsunami Tsolutions is seeking a Production Support Analyst who enjoys solving application and data problems, working directly with clients, and turning each resolution into clearer knowledge for the team. This role provides Tier 1 support for Maintenix, EData+, and related service-management tools while protecting data integrity, service commitments, security, and a consistent client experience. The Production Support Analyst owns routine issues from intake through confirmation of resolution and is expected to resolve approximately 70–80% of assigned requests before escalation. When deeper expertise is required, the Analyst provides Tier II and other technical resources with clear analysis, supporting evidence, and reproduction details.

Responsibilities

  • Manage helpdesk calls, emails, database inquiries, and YouTrack tickets; work directly with clients to clarify needs, communicate status and next steps, and confirm resolution.
  • Troubleshoot Maintenix and related application, navigation, access, data, and business-process issues using approved procedures and tools.
  • Investigate discrepancies, implement approved routine corrections, and escalate complex, high-impact, recurring, or security-sensitive issues with complete analysis and evidence.
  • Test software connected to reported issues and perform full or targeted Formal Qualification Review (FQR) testing using approved procedures and acceptance criteria.
  • Administer EData+ access only after required authorization, identity validation, segregation-of-duties checks, and documentation are complete.
  • Maintain complete ticket records, client-interaction notes, resolution evidence, knowledge articles, standard operating procedures, and reusable troubleshooting guidance.
  • Partner with supervisors, specialists, process owners, and the Sustainment Process and Data Analyst to resolve issues and improve support processes.
  • Use approved automation and AI tools while meeting all security, privacy, quality, human-review, and client requirements.
